Output 0aef102d2878a93c5a88d7675c7062548dfc7bb769f57b4d54d0f138763fa7b3:2

value
24127416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fa1f74af260e5b8d90ed85e32d248e816f504de OP_EQUAL
address
MCF223Hr7R3NasxKNtJJgUX3upZ6cbHHzQ
transaction
0aef102d2878a93c5a88d7675c7062548dfc7bb769f57b4d54d0f138763fa7b3
spent
true